PREGNANT PASSENGER

A female employee got lucky after she was mistaken to be pregnant by a jeepney dispatcher during rush hour.

Seeing that most of the jeepneys were filled, she took advantage of the situation and didn’t correct the dispatcher who helped her get inside the jeepney.

BUKO JUICE

Wanting to buy buko (coconut) juice from a passing vendor, a female employee told her female coworker to buy BJ or buko juice for her, promising to pay her once she brings the drink to her.

A guard who overheard the female employee shook his head in disapproval. Apparently, he thought she was referring to something else, and the female employee could only laugh at his ignorance.

REAL FOOD

A street kid begged for food from passersby while holding a cup of fruit shake. One of the passersby asked the kid why he still begs for food when he has a fruit shake.

The little kid looked at his fruit shake before offering it to the man, asking him if he could give him food.
